Upload
mahina
View
30
Download
0
Embed Size (px)
DESCRIPTION
Networking From Physical to Virtual. 100% Physical Environment. Devices on Management Network. Devices on iSCSI /NFS Network. OS A pps. OS A pps. VLAN 15. VLAN 10. Trunk. Physical Network. Physical and Virtual Environment. Devices on Management Network. - PowerPoint PPT Presentation
Citation preview
© 2009 VMware Inc. All rights reserved
NetworkingFrom Physical to Virtual
2 Confidential
100% Physical Environment
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
Trunk
3 Confidential
Physical and Virtual Environment
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1
Trunk
4 Confidential
Creating a Virtual Machine
OSApps
5 Confidential
# of Network Cards
6 Confidential
Selecting the VLAN/Network for the Virtual Machine
7 Confidential
Selecting the Network Card
8 Confidential
A Virtual Machine is a set of files
9 Confidential
MAC Address
10 Confidential
What does the OS see for NIC?
11 Confidential
What does the OS See?
© 2009 VMware Inc. All rights reserved
Confidential
vNetwork Standard Switch
13 Confidential
Physical and Virtual Environment
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1
Trunk
14 Confidential
Base Networking Configuration
15 Confidential
Creating a Port Group for Virtual Machine
16 Confidential
Selecting the Physical Network Card(s)
17 Confidential
Setting the VLAN for 1st Port Group
18 Confidential
Adding Additional Port Groups
19 Confidential
VMkernel – Virtual Network Cards for ESX
20 Confidential
Types of Traffics for VMkernel
21 Confidential
VSS - Load Balancing
22 Confidential
VSS - Network Failover Detection
23 Confidential
VSS - Security
24 Confidential
VSS - Traffic Shaping
25 Confidential
VSS - Completed Networking
26 Confidential
Physical with 1 ESX Host
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1
Trunk
27 Confidential
Physical with 2 ESX Hosts
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
VLAN 10 VLAN 20
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1 ESX2
Trunk
28 Confidential
VMotion
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
VLAN 20
Devices on iSCSI/NFS
Network
Devices on Management
NetworkOS
Apps
ESX1 ESX2
Trunk
29 Confidential
VMotion
Physical Network
VLAN 10
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
VLAN 15 VLAN 20
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1 ESX2
Trunk
© 2009 VMware Inc. All rights reserved
Confidential
vNetwork Distributed Switch
31 Confidential
VMware Distributed Switch
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
VLAN 10 VLAN 20
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1 ESX2
UpLink1
UpLink2
UpLink3
Trunk
32 Confidential
VMware Distributed Switch
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
VLAN 10 VLAN 20
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1 ESX2
UpLink1
UpLink2
UpLink3
Trunk
33 Confidential
VMware Distributed Switches
34 Confidential
DVS – Base Configuration
35 Confidential
DVS – New Port Group
36 Confidential
DVS – Types of Port Groups
37 Confidential
DVS – Port Group Configuration
38 Confidential
DVS – Configured with 2 Port Groups
39 Confidential
DVS – Load Balancing
40 Confidential
DVS – Add Hosts
41 Confidential
Virtual NICs
42 Confidential
Networking – Final Configuration
© 2009 VMware Inc. All rights reserved
Confidential
Cisco Nexus 1000v
44 Confidential
Cisco Nexus 1000v
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
VLAN 10 VLAN 20
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1 ESX2
UpLink1
UpLink2
UpLink3
Trunk
45 Confidential
Networking – Installation VSM
46 Confidential
Networking – Installation VEM
47 Confidential
Configuration the VSM
48 Confidential
Networking
49 Confidential
Keep your process consistent
Network Administrator view
N1k-VSM# sh port-profile name Ubuntu-VMport-profile Ubuntu-VM description: status: enabled capability uplink: no capability l3control: no system vlans: none port-group: Ubuntu-VM max-ports: 32 inherit: config attributes: switchport mode access switchport access vlan 95 no shutdownassigned interfaces: Vethernet2 Vethernet4
Server Administrator view
© 2009 VMware Inc. All rights reserved
Confidential
Blade Chassis Configuration
51 Confidential
Blade Chassis with 2 Blades using Standard Switch
Blade Chassis
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
VLAN 10 VLAN 20
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1 ESX2
52 Confidential
Blade Chassis with 2 Blades using Distributed Switch
Blade Chassis
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
VLAN 10 VLAN 20
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1 ESX2
UpLink1
UpLink2
UpLink3
© 2009 VMware Inc. All rights reserved
Confidential
VMware Network IO Control
54 Confidential
Network IO Control
Blade Chassis
Physical Network
VLAN 10 VLAN 15
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
VLAN 10 VLAN 20
Devices on iSCSI/NFS
Network
Devices on Management
Network
OSApps
OSApps
ESX1 ESX2
© 2009 VMware Inc. All rights reserved
Confidential
Switch Feature Comparison
56 Confidential
Switch Feature Comparison – 1 of 3
FeatureESX 3.5: Standard vSwitch
VMware 4u1: vNetwork Standard
Switch
VMware 4u1: vNetwork
Distributed Switch
Cisco Nexus 1000V 1.2
Switching FeaturesLayer 2 Forwarding Yes Yes Yes Yes
IEEE 802.1Q VLAN Tagging Yes Yes Yes Yes
Multicast Support (IGMP v2 and v3) Yes Yes Yes Yes
IGMPv3 Snooping - - - Yes
VMware VMotion Support Yes Yes Yes Yes
Network VMware VMotion (Network Policy) - - Yes Yes
Upstream Switch ConnectivityVirtual MAC Pinning Yes Yes Yes Yes
EtherChannel Yes Yes Yes Yes
Virtual Port Channels - - - Yes
Link Aggregation Control Protocol (LACP) - - - Yes
Load Balancing Algorithms Virtual Switchport ID Yes Yes Yes Yes
Source MAC Yes Yes Yes Yes
Source and Destination IP Yes Yes Yes Yes
Source and Destination MAC - - - Yes
Source and Destination Port IP - - - Yes
Additional Hashing Options - - - Yes
57 Confidential
Switch Feature Comparison – 2 of 3
FeatureESX 3.5: Standard vSwitch
VMware 4u1: vNetwork Standard
Switch
VMware 4u1: vNetwork
Distributed Switch
Cisco Nexus 1000V 1.2
Traffic Management Features Tx Rate Limiting (from virtual machine) Yes Yes Yes Yes
Rx Rate Limiting (from virtual machine) - - Yes Yes
iSCSI Multipathing - Yes Yes Yes
Quality-of-service (QoS) markingDifferentiated Services Code Point (DSCP) - - - Yes
Type of Service - - - Yes
Class of Service - - - Yes
Security FeaturesPort Security Yes Yes Yes Yes
VMware VMSafe compatible Yes Yes Yes Yes
Private VLANs (PVLANs) - - Yes Yes
Local PVLAN enforcement - - - Yes
Access Control Lists (ACL) - - - Yes
DHCP Snooping - - - Yes
IP Source Guard - - - Yes
Dynamic ARP Inspection - - - Yes
Virtual Service Domain - - - Yes
58 Confidential
Switch Feature Comparison – 3 of 3
FeatureESX 3.5: Standard vSwitch
VMware 4u1: vNetwork Standard
Switch
VMware 4u1: vNetwork
Distributed Switch
Cisco Nexus 1000V 1.2
Management FeaturesVMware vCenter Support Yes Yes Yes Yes
Third Party Accessible APIs Yes Yes Yes Yes
Network Policy Groups Yes Yes Yes Yes
VMware port mirroring (promiscuous) Yes Yes Yes -
Multi-Tier Policy Groups (inheritance) - - - Yes
SPAN - - - Yes
ERSPAN - - - Yes
Netflow v9 - - - Yes
SNMP v3 Read/Write - - - Yes
CDP v1/v2 Yes Yes Yes Yes
Syslog ** ** ** Yes
Packet Capture & Analysis - - - Yes
Radius/TACACS+ - - - YesConfiguration and management console and interface VI Client VI Client VI Client to VMware
vCenter ServerVMware vCenter
and Cisco CLIIPv6 for Management - Yes Yes Yes
NX-OS XML API - - - Yes
59 Confidential
ICONS
Nexus 1000
Nexus 1KV VSM
Workgroup Switch